Definition
Pronunciation: //tɪt//
noun
- (slang, vulgar, chiefly in the plural) A person's breast or nipple."I have enjoyed taking to my writing bureau and writing about poverty, benefit reform and the coalition government in the manner of a shit Dickens, or Orwell, but with tits."
- (slang, vulgar) An animal's teat or udder."A large bowl of suckulent ^([sic]) raspberries with clotted yellow cream fresh from the goat's tit on the diamond and ruby-studded glass end-table."
- (UK, Ireland, derogatory, slang) An idiot; a fool."Look at that tit driving on the wrong side of the road!"
- (UK, Ireland, slang, derogatory) A police officer; a "tithead".
noun
- (archaic) A light blow or hit (now usually in the phrase tit for tat).
verb
- (transitive or intransitive, obsolete) To strike lightly, tap, pat."Come tit me, come tat me, come throw a kiss at me—how is that?"
- (transitive, obsolete) To taunt, to reproach."they would vpbraid me therewith calling me idle Drone; Titting and flouting at me, that I should offer to sit downe at boord with cleane hand."
noun
- (archaic) A small horse; a nag."[…] he was reſolved, for the time to come, to ride his tit with more ſobriety."
- (archaic) A young girl, later especially a minx, hussy.""What sort of a feringee is this?" said a lively little tit—"eh?""

What's the difference between Scrabble and Words With Friends points?
While many letters share the same point values, there are several key differences between Scrabble and Words With Friends point values:
- B, C, M, P: Worth 3 points in Scrabble, but 4 points in Words With Friends
- H, Y: Worth 4 points in Scrabble, but 3 points in Words With Friends
- L, N, U: Worth 1 point in Scrabble, but 2 points in Words With Friends
- V: Worth 4 points in Scrabble, but 5 points in Words With Friends
- J: Worth 8 points in Scrabble, but 10 points in Words With Friends
Note: These are base letter values. Actual game scores also depend on bonus squares (Double/Triple Letter/Word) and board placement, which differ between the two games. See the complete Scrabble point values and Words With Friends point values for full reference.
